We also enjoy a few great dinners on our short stay.  After arriving, we head over to Mon Ami Gabi in the Paris Las Vegas Hotel & Casino, sitting outside on the balcony with a great view of the fountains and water display at Bellagio across the street.  We feast on steak with frites and a bouillabaisse (full of great seafood) and watch the crowds go by on Las Vegas Boulevard.

 Steak frites and bouillabaisse

Our other diner is at Scarpetta, in the Cosmopolitan.  We've tried to get reservations at Scarpetta in New York and never been able to get in.  At home, we make one of their famous dishes, Spaghetti with Tomato and Basil, and tonight we get to try some others:  Mediterranean octopus (with marbled potato, green tomato, nduja onion jam, and salsa verde), buratta salad (with pesto, roasted pepper, heirloom tomato, and balsamic),  lobster risotto (with corn and cherry tomatoes),  short rib agnolotti (with brown butter, horseradish and toasted breadcrumbs), and duck and fois gras ravioli (with a marsala reduction).
